Where Traditional Systems Fall Short
Let’s be real—traditional energy solutions have their flaws. They often rely on a single source, whether that’s solar or battery storage, which limits efficiency. This approach can lead to unpredictable outages and higher energy bills. A hybrid energy storage system combines the best of both worlds. Think of it as the best buddy system for power. You get reliability without blowing the budget.

What’s Brewing in Power Innovation?
The energy landscape is evolving, and fast! Looking ahead, the adoption of a microgrid system will significantly enhance how we view energy consumption, especially in industrial settings. These microgrids allow for localized control, meaning you can depend on energy customized for your needs. I’ve seen companies that invested in these systems lower their operational costs by up to 20%. Now, that’s smart money!
